R/GA has appointed Urvashi Shivdasani as its new global Chief Financial Officer, marking the agency’s first global C-suite appointment since regaining independence through a partnership with private equity firm Truelink Capital.
Shivdasani joins R/GA from Huge, where she served as global CFO, overseeing various finance and operations functions, including accounting, FP&A, real estate, commercial finance, resource management, and IT. She also played a key role in Huge’s transition to private equity ownership. Previously, she held senior finance positions at Ralph Lauren and Discovery Communications.
In her new role at R/GA, Shivdasani will collaborate closely with CEO Robin Forbes and the global leadership team to define the agency’s financial strategy, optimize operational efficiency, and support the transition to a more flexible, outcomes-based commercial model.
“Urvashi’s extensive experience and strategic acumen will be invaluable as we chart R/GA’s course as an independent agency and activate a new commercial model based on outcomes and not hours. Her track record of driving financial success and operational excellence will be critical as we continue to invest in innovation and new ways of working,” said Forbes.
Shivdasani’s appointment comes as agencies face growing pressure to shift away from traditional payment structures, influenced by advancements in AI and a stronger focus on efficiency. She will also oversee the strategic deployment of R/GA’s newly launched $50 million Innovation Fund.
